We are seeking a highly skilled and detail-oriented Accountant to join our finance team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for managing all aspects of financial accounting, ensuring compliance with US GAAP and tax regulations, supporting external audits, and improving financial processes. This role requires strong analytical skills, a proactive approach to problem-solving, and the ability to collaborate across departments.

What you'll be doing:

  • Assist in month-end and year-end close process, including preparation of journal entries, reconciliations, accruals, and financial statement analysis.
  • Ensure accuracy and integrity in financial reporting and compliance with US GAAP, tax laws, regulatory requirements and company policies.
  • Prepare and analyze financial statements, identifying trends and variances.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to ensure the completeness and accuracy of financial data.
  • Assist in the development and implementation of financial policies and procedures to improve efficiency and compliance.
  • Manage and respond to audit requests, ensuring timely and accurate submission of financial data.
  • Assist in tax filings, regulatory reporting, and compliance with local, state, and federal laws.
  • Identify and implement process improvements, automation opportunities, and best practices to enhance operational efficiency.
  • Stay updated with changes in accounting regulations, financial reporting standards, and industry best practices.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in accounting, finance or related field along with 2+ years of experience
  • CPA certification is required
  • Strong understanding of US GAAP, financial multi-currency reporting requirements, and internal controls.
  • Experience with NetSuite is preferred, and proficiency in Concur for expense and invoice management and Floqast for reconciliations is highly valued.
  • Analytical mindset with the ability to identify inefficiencies and propose actionable solutions.
  • Strong proficiency in Microsoft Excel, including advanced functions.
  • Excellent organizational and multitasking skills, with strong attention to detail.
  • Proactive individual with the ability to work independently, manage multiple priorities, and meet tight deadlines.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ams.
  • Experience in the Contract Research Organization (CRO) industry is a plus.
